Key Financial Metrics
The filing does not provide specific revenue, profit, cash flow, or debt figures. It addresses a qualitative accounting error regarding financial derivatives embedded in convertible notes and warrants issued in 2005.
- Accounting Error: Failure to identify and account for embedded derivatives in accordance with SFAS No. 133 and EITF 00-19.
- Impact: Failure to record a derivative liability, deemed interest expense, and charges associated with changes in the value of embedded derivatives.
Material Changes Versus Prior Period
The filing announces a material restatement of financial statements for the periods ended June 30, 2005, and September 30, 2005. The previously filed Form 10-QSB reports for these periods are no longer reliable. The restatement will result in:
- Booking of a liability associated with embedded derivatives.
- A corresponding discount in related convertible notes payable.
- A charge to earnings for deemed interest arising from the derivatives.
- An additional expense item representing the change in the value of the derivative.
Guidance, Outlook, and Management Commentary
Management Action: The Company intends to amend its Form 10-QSB for the periods ended June 30, 2005, and September 30, 2005, to include restated financial statements as soon as possible.
Context: The error was identified by the independent registered public accounting firm during the preparation of the Form 10-KSB for the year ended December 31, 2005. The Company notes that the embedded derivatives were properly accounted for as of December 31, 2005, and in the June 30, 2006 Form 10-QSB. The decision to file this 8-K and amend prior 10-QSBs followed the hiring of a full-time Chief Financial Officer and the preparation of the September 30, 2006 Form 10-QSB.
